For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 196 students in Baylor County, TX.
The top-ranked public middle school in Baylor County, TX is Seymour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Baylor County, TX public middle school have an average math proficiency score of 67% (versus the Texas public middle school average of 43%), and reading proficiency score of 67% (versus the 52% statewide average). Middle schools in Baylor County have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 5% of Texas public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 34%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Texas public middle school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
